Cuckfield Conservation Area

Cuckfield is a mid-sized conservation area in England, covering approximately 27 hectares of protected landscape. The area has been designated to preserve its distinctive character, including its historic buildings, street patterns, and open spaces. The area contains 76 listed buildings, highlighting its exceptional concentration of heritage assets.

What restrictions apply in Cuckfield?
Properties in Cuckfield Conservation Area may face restrictions on demolition, tree work (6 weeks' notice required), and certain exterior alterations. Contact your local planning authority for specific rules that apply here.
